WebMedications for Upper Respiratory Tract Infection Other names: Respiratory Tract Infection, Upper; URI; URTI Upper Respiratory Tract Infection (URTI) is a term used to describe acute infections of the nose, throat, ears, and sinuses. Most URTIs are caused by viruses. They are the most common illness to result in missed days off work or school. dan cathy 2012 statements

WebFeb 16, 2024 · Antibiotics belonging to the aminoglycoside class typically end in the suffix “mycin/micin”. Examples of aminoglycosides include gentamicin, tobramycin, neomycin, and streptomycin. Image: Aminoglycoside drug names typically end in “mycin/micin”. Examples include streptomycin and gentamicin. Cephalosporins = Begin with “Cef/Ceph”
